The Social Security application gives 1894 as the birth year. The headstone gives 1895. Both have 02 Oct. I do not know what the birth certificate and death certificate give. Her son, Earl, says that the headstone is incorrect and should read 1894. He always knew his mother was a day and a year older than his father.

In the 1900 Fed. Census for Texas (vol. 1, enum. district 5, sheet 15, line 24) we see Alma's parents living at 814 Magnolia St. in Palestine, Anderson County, Texas. Her mother Rena is 32, born in Mar. 1868 in Texas. Her father, Jas. (sic! John) W. Vossler is 36 years old, born in Missouri in Feb. 1864. Alma's brother Jas. (James) M. Vossler is 7 years old, born in Texas in Aug. 1892. Alma is 5, born in Sept. 1894 in Texas. Also living there is Rena's mother, Mary E. Mears, 52 years old, born in July 1847 in Texas and Kate Mears, Rena's sister, 23 years old, born Oct. 1876 in Texas. This Census reports that Rena and John were married for 9 years and that Rena had 2 children, both of which are living. It says that both parents of John were born in Germany; that the father of Rena was born in Missouri and the mother of Rena in North Carolina. It reports that Alma's father, John, is a stenographer and that they own their home.

The 1910 Fed. Census for Texas (16 Apr. 1910, enum. district 9, supv. district 7, ward 3, page 2) shows the family living in Palestine, Anderson County, Texas. Alma's mother Rena is 42 years old, born in Texas of parents born in Missouri and North Carolina. Alma's father is 46 years old, born in Missouri with parents born in Germany. He is a clerk for the railroad and owns his house. Rena and her husband had only two children and have been married 19 years. Alma is 15, born in Texas. Her brother, Jas. M is 18, born in Texas.

The 1917 Houston Texas City Directory lists John W. Vossler, stationer for I. & G.N. residing at 1603 Crawford in Houston, Texas. Alma Vossler is boarding there.

The 1920 Census for Texas (vol. 88, enum. district 57, sheet 18, line 64) shows Alma's mother, Rena Vosler (sic!), 51 years old, born in Texas, as a roomer in the home of Mattie McBride on East Rusk (#203) in Marshall, Harrison County, Texas. With them is Rena's husband, John W. Vosler (sic!) 55 years old, born in Missouri, who is an agent at a railroad station. Also there is Alma Vosler (sic!) who is 25 years old, born in Texas. Rena's sister Kate and her mother Mary and son Jas. are no longer living with them. James is living elsewhere [He had married and had a son in 1918].

On 22 Nov. 1921 Alma got married (to Emory Austin).
Two pictures from Nov. 1921 are combined here to show the couple in the month of their wedding. Appreciation is extended to her son for these pictures.

They first moved to Dallas, Texas where their son Earl was born on 09 Sept. 1922..

The 1930 Fed. Census for Texas (T626_2318, supv. dist. 10, enum. dist. 71, page 4A, printed page no. 4, lines 1-3, dated 03 April) shows the family living at 4149? McKinney Ave. in Dallas, Dallas County (Justice Precinct 11, voting precinct 98, block 1621). They are renting at $25/month and own a radio set. Amory is 34 years old, married at 26, born in Missouri of a father born in Illinois and a mother born in Missouri. He was working for an oil company (can't read the occupation but it looks like some kind or clerk). He was a veteran of WW1. He was not in school but can read, write, and speak English. Alma is also 34 according to this Census [she is really 35]. She was married at age 26 [27] and was born in Texas of a father born in Illinois [other records say Missouri] and a mother born in Texas. No occupation is listed. She was not in school but can read, write, and speak English. Their son, Amory Jr., is 7 years old, born in Texas of a father born in Missouri and a mother born in Texas. He is attending school.

Her mother died on 01 Nov. 1938 in Houston?, TX. Her father died on 24 May 1939 in Houston (or Palestine), TX.

After several years they moved to Chicago, IL. Later (perhaps when Amory retired before 1958) they moved to Mountain View, MO.

Her husband died at 6:45 A.M. on 03 Jul. 1958 in St. Francis Hospital, Mountain View, MO and was buried next to his father in New Salem Cemetery near Couch, MO. Duncan Funeral Home was in charge of the funeral. At the time of his death he had two granddaughters, a cousin, son and wife (Alma).

Alma continued to live in Mountain View, MO for a while after the death of her husband. Here is a picture of her home. Date is unknown, but probably between 1958 and 1965. Picture obtained by courtesy of her son. Click to enlarge.

In the Spring of 1964 she went to as meeting of the St. Clair chapter of Easter Star. Her first cousin Cecilia Mueller (née Thake) was being awarded a 50-year pin for her service in the Easter Star. A newspaper article reported this event. At the time Alma was living in Mountain View, MO.

Her last move was to an Eastern Star nursing home in Macon, IL.

She applied for a Social Security number (#493-54-7980) in 1965 when she was living in Zip Code Area 62544 which is in Macon, Macon County, IL, just south of Decatur. The application has 1894 as her birth year. She was living at the Eastern Star home there.

She died 01 Mar. 1975 in Macon, IL and was buried in New Salem Cemetery in Couch, Oregon County, MO. According to her son, Earl, the birthyear on the headstone is incorrect and should read 1894.
